TL;DR
Client Leaving Administrator (Financial Services Operations): Managing client departure, asset release, payment, and account closure workflows in a controlled wealth management environment with an accent on operational accuracy, regulatory compliance, and stakeholder coordination. Focus on investigating exceptions, improving workflows through automation and AI-enabled tools, and maintaining reliable client records and controls.

Location: London, United Kingdom; hybrid working with a minimum of three days per week in the office after training. During the initial training period, attendance is required five days per week.

Company

A UK wealth management firm providing discretionary investment management and financial advice to private clients, charities, trustees, and professional partners.

What you will do

  • Monitor and manage client leaver and account closure workflows.
  • Review and authorise outgoing client payments in line with procedures and authority levels.
  • Coordinate with Investment Managers, Front Office, and Operations teams to complete client departures on time.
  • Investigate and resolve issues delaying the release of client assets or cash, escalating risks, exceptions, and aged items.
  • Update client records accurately and maintain regulatory and internal controls.
  • Support workflow monitoring, management information, process improvement, automation, standardisation, and cross-training across Custody & Nominees.

Requirements

  • 2–3 years of experience in a Financial Services Operations role.
  • Strong organisational skills, attention to detail, and problem-solving and investigative abilities.
  • Ability to build effective relationships with stakeholders and communicate clearly in writing and verbally.
  • Proactive, collaborative approach and ability to work accurately in a controlled environment.
  • Comfort using digital, automation, and AI-enabled tools while maintaining accuracy, regulatory compliance, data protection, and information security.
  • Ability to attend the London office five days per week during training and at least three days per week thereafter.

Culture & Benefits

  • Permanent employment within the Custody & Nominees department.
  • Hybrid working after completion of the initial training period.
  • 26 days of holiday, equivalent to 182 hours.
  • Non-contributory pension scheme, private medical insurance, life assurance, and income protection.
  • Employee incentive scheme and flexible benefits for UK employees.
  • Inclusive culture focused on integrity, curiosity, challenge, collaboration, and continuous improvement.
